The correct option is 2: This question relates to the Harrod-Domar growth model, which provides a basic framework for understanding economic growth. The model states that the warranted rate of economic growth (g) is determined by the rate of savings (s, or investment level of GDP) and the Capital-Output Ratio (COR or c).
